What is Cryptocurrency?
At its core, cryptocurrency is a type of digital or virtual currency that uses cryptography for security. Unlike traditional currencies issued by governments, cryptocurrencies operate on decentralized networks based on blockchain technology. This means no single entity controls them, allowing for greater freedom and security in transactions.

The Mechanics of Cryptocurrency
How does it work? Let’s break it down:
-
Blockchain Technology: This is the backbone of cryptocurrencies. It’s a secure and transparent ledger that records all transactions across a network. Each block in the chain contains multiple transactions, and once a block is filled, it’s added to the chain in a way that is immutable and secure.
-
Decentralization: In contrast to traditional banking systems, cryptocurrencies are decentralized. This means that no central authority governs them, providing more freedom to users and reducing the risk of manipulation or fraud.
-
Mining and Transactions: Cryptocurrencies are generated through a process called mining, wherein powerful computers solve complex mathematical problems to validate transactions. Once validated, these transactions are added to the blockchain, ensuring transparency and trust.
Why the Surge?
The rise of crypto can be attributed to several key factors:
-
Financial Inclusion: Over 1.7 billion people globally are unbanked. Crypto offers a solution for those without access to traditional banking services. With just a smartphone and internet connection, anyone can participate in the global economy.
-
Inflation Hedge: With inflation rates rising, many are turning to crypto as a store of value. Unlike fiat currencies, many cryptocurrencies have a capped supply, making them less susceptible to devaluation.
-
Global Transactions: Cryptocurrencies allow for faster and cheaper cross-border transactions. You can send money to anyone, anywhere, without the hefty fees typically associated with traditional banking systems.
-
Investment Opportunities: The price volatility of cryptocurrencies can be risky, but it also presents significant investment opportunities. Early adopters of Bitcoin and Ethereum have made substantial returns, sparking interest among new investors.

Challenges and Concerns
While the rise of crypto presents exciting opportunities, it’s not without challenges. Here are a few to consider:
-
Regulatory Concerns: Governments worldwide are grappling with how to regulate cryptocurrencies. The lack of clear regulations can be daunting for investors and users alike.
-
Volatility: The price of cryptocurrencies can swing dramatically in short periods. While this can offer high rewards, it also poses significant risks.
-
Security Issues: Although blockchain technology is secure, exchanges and wallets can be vulnerable to hacks. It’s crucial to educate yourself on best practices for securing your investments.
